Comprehending Contract surety Bonds
When you enter the world of construction and contracting, recognizing contract surety bonds comes to be necessary. These bonds act as a safeguard, making certain that jobs are completed as concurred.
They entail 3 celebrations: you (the contractor), the project owner (obligee), and the surety business. You'll need a surety bond to guarantee your performance and protect the owner from potential losses if you fall short to meet your obligations.
It's not simply a procedure-- it enhances your credibility and can be a demand for bidding process on certain jobs. Understanding the various types, like performance bonds and repayment bonds, will certainly much better equip you to browse your contracting ventures.
This understanding can dramatically affect your success and online reputation in the sector.
The Process of Getting a surety Bond
Acquiring a surety bond might appear complicated, however it's a straightforward procedure once you understand the steps included.
First, you'll need to gather essential info about your service, including economic statements, credit history, and project information.
Next, study surety bond firms and select one that lines up with your demands.
Afterwards, you'll complete a bond application, providing your gathered information.
The surety business will then assess your application, evaluating your credit reliability and financial security.
If accepted, you'll get a bond quote, which details the premium and terms.
Ultimately, when you accept the terms and pay the costs, the bond is released, and you can wage your contracting job, positive you have actually fulfilled the essential demands.
